BACKGROUND The central nervous system, composed of the brain and spinal cord, controls cognitive functions, interprets incoming sensory information and organizes body movements. The peripheral nervous system, composed of nerve fibers leading to and from the central nervous system, carries encoded information from body sensory receptors and commands to muscles and glands. Two main cell types are found throughout the nervous system: nerve cells, which generate and transmit signals, and glial cells, which provide nutrition and support functions to nerve cells. Information in the nervous system travels within individual nerve cells as electrical signals and is passed from one nerve cell to another by chemical substances, known as neurotransmitters, which act on cellular receptors to generate or modify electrical activity of the receiving nerve cell. Electrical signals of the nervous system are generated by membrane proteins, known as ion channels, which control the flow of charged ions across nerve cell membranes. Disorders of the nervous system fall broadly into two categories: those in which the cellular structure of the nervous system is intact, but the electrical signals of the cellular network are abnormal; and those in which the degeneration of nerve or glial cells leads to abnormal function. Acute central nervous system disorders, such as stroke and traumatic injuries to the head and spine, often cause a reduction in blood flow (ischemia) to, and the premature death of, nerve cells, resulting in permanent disorders of the central nervous system. Nerve cell death following an ischemic event in the brain is triggered by the excessive release of the excitatory neurotransmitter, glutamate, from damaged nerve terminals, which in turn stimulates the massive entry of calcium into nerve cells through activated ion channels. Overloading nerve cells with calcium ions activates a number of processes that ultimately result in cell death. In the ischemic brain, glutamate predominantly activates an ion channel known as the NMDA ion channel. In animal models of stroke and TBI, NMDA antagonists have been shown to limit the extent of brain damage when administered after the onset of cerebral ischemia. Chronic disorders of the nervous system, such as multiple sclerosis, peripheral neuropathies and other degenerative disorders, are known to result from the death of nerve or glial cells. In the development of the nervous system, the proliferation, differentiation and survival of nerve and glial cells are controlled by a variety of protein growth factors. These growth factors are produced by cells of the nervous system and by their target cells. Growth factors, which are normally involved in the development of the nervous system, also play important roles during the normal regeneration of the nervous system following damage. Animal studies suggest that one attractive therapeutic approach to replacing damaged nerve and glial cells is to re-initiate the processes of early development in the nervous system through the introduction of protein growth factors. Therefore, protein growth factors offer significant potential as treatments for a variety of neurological disorders. 25 27 CORE TECHNOLOGIES Cambridge NeuroScience has concentrated its drug discovery and development efforts in two main programs: ion-channel blockers to modify nerve cell signaling or to prevent nerve cell death; and protein growth factors to prevent degeneration of, or to regenerate, nerve and glial cells. ION-CHANNEL BLOCKERS The Company has focused on the synthesis of small organic molecules, known as ion-channel blockers, that directly block passage of ions through certain ion channels which control the activity of nerve cells. The Company has been synthesizing and evaluating small molecules that block ion channels which regulate the release of glutamate from nerve cells or the responses of nerve cells to glutamate. In cerebral ischemia, over-stimulation of the glutamate-activated NMDA ion channel is primarily responsible for flooding nerve cells with calcium ions, which results in cell death. The Company is developing ion-channel blockers that selectively block the NMDA ion channel and limit nerve cell death during acute cerebral ischemia as a treatment for TBI and stroke. CERESTAT, the Company's most advanced NMDA ion-channel blocker, is currently undergoing Phase III clinical trials in both TBI and stroke. The Phase III clinical trials of CERESTAT are being managed by the Company and its collaborative partner, BI. CNS 5161, the second development compound selected by the Company from its NMDA ion-channel blockers project, is being advanced towards clinical trials as a potential treatment to reduce post-surgical neuropathic pain and to limit the neurological deficits which sometimes result from major cardiac surgeries. The Company has applied its expertise in discovering and developing NMDA ion-channel blockers to the synthesis and testing of compounds that selectively block other ion channels, such as sodium ion channels, which can contribute to abnormal nerve cell electrical activity. The Company believes that such ion-channel blockers may have therapeutic utility in a number of acute and chronic neurological disorders, including spinal cord injury, migraine and epilepsy. The Company's ion-channel blocker product candidates for the treatment of acute and chronic neurological disorders are being designed with the following characteristics: Rapid Brain Penetration. In animal models of cerebral ischemia, the more rapidly drugs intended to prevent nerve cell death reach the area of the brain at risk, the greater the degree of protection. Because of their physical characteristics, the Company's small molecule ion-channel blockers readily penetrate the blood-brain barrier in animals. The Company believes that effective brain concentrations of ion-channel blockers can be rapidly achieved in patients. Early Intervention in Nerve Cell Death. The massive influx of lethal levels of calcium into the cell is one of the earliest in a sequence of events leading to nerve cell death. The Company believes that its ion-channel blockers, by acting at an early stage in this process, can effectively shut down all subsequent biochemical processes in this pathway that lead to nerve cell death. High Potency. Ion-channel blockers can shut down operations of activated ion channels, regardless of the strength of the naturally occurring stimulus. Potential products that inhibit the function of an ion channel by other mechanisms often can be overwhelmed by an increase in the activating stimulus. 26 28 PROTEIN GROWTH FACTORS Growth factors are known to play an important role in the growth, differentiation and distribution of nerve cells. See "--Strategic Alliances." 28 30 ION-CHANNEL BLOCKERS CERESTAT: Background CERESTAT, the Company's most advanced product candidate, is currently undergoing a Phase III clinical trial in both TBI and stroke. The Phase III clinical trials of CERESTAT are being managed by the Company and its collaborative partner, BI. A coordinated series of Phase I and Phase II clinical trials was undertaken to ascertain the safety of CERESTAT in over 400 volunteers and patients. These clinical trials were conducted to determine the safe and tolerable doses and dosing regimens that result in a plasma level of the compound equivalent to, or higher than, the minimum plasma level of the compound ("target plasma level") that is associated with the limitation of brain damage in animal models of cerebral ischemia. Four studies were performed in volunteers, including a study in Japan that was conducted by BI in the second half of 1996 as the initiation of clinical development in that country. See "-- Strategic Alliances." In TBI patients, two studies were conducted to determine a dosing regimen that would produce a plasma level of CERESTAT three times the target plasma level. Following the first study in which CERESTAT was administered on a weight-adjusted basis over a four-hour period, the second study demonstrated that a non-weight-adjusted dosing regimen could safely maintain such a plasma level for 72 hours. Non-weight-adjusted dosing regimens are more easily administered in clinical trials and offer marketing advantages. In stroke patients, three studies were undertaken to determine a dosing regimen that would produce a plasma level of CERESTAT equivalent to, or greater than, the target plasma level. The first was used to determine the safety of escalating doses of CERESTAT over a four-hour treatment period. The second was a dose-response trial. In this clinical trial, at 90 days after treatment, the improvement in neurological function (NIH Stroke Scale) of patients treated with the highest dose tested was significantly better than that of placebo-treated patients. A third study determined that a non-weight-adjusted dosing regimen could safely maintain the target plasma level over a 12-hour period. The results of these Phase I and Phase II clinical trials were used by the Company and BI to design the Phase III clinical trials in TBI and stroke patients described below. There can be no assurance that the results of Phase I and Phase II clinical trials will be indicative of results in Phase III clinical trials or that Phase III clinical trials will show that CERESTAT is sufficiently safe and efficacious for marketing approval by the FDA or other regulatory authorities. CERESTAT: Traumatic Brain Injury It is estimated that approximately 500,000 individuals suffer severe injuries to the head each year in the United States. Brain damage results from the trauma and from subsequent cerebral ischemia. The annual economic cost of TBI to the United States has been estimated to be more than $40.0 billion. The current Phase III clinical trial of CERESTAT is designed to treat a subset of comatose patients with TBI. At present, there are no FDA-approved treatments that limit or reduce the brain damage associated with traumatic injuries to the head. Based on the safety and tolerance findings from the Phase I and Phase II clinical trials, the Company and its collaborative partner BI initiated a Phase III efficacy trial for CERESTAT in TBI patients in March 1996. The intent is to enroll 700 patients at approximately 70 centers in the United States, Canada and certain European countries. Patients enrolled in the trial are randomized for intravenous treatment with either CERESTAT or placebo. The primary outcome measure has been defined as the percentage of patients with a "favorable" outcome on the Glasgow Outcome Scale representing good recovery or moderate disability six months after the injury. An interim analysis is planned to be performed on the three-month Glasgow Outcome Scale data of approximately the first half of the patients. The main purpose of the interim analysis is administrative, and the trial would be halted only if continuation were futile. To date, over 170 patients have been enrolled in this trial. This trial is being monitored by an independent safety committee. In TBI patients, no adverse drug-related effects have been observed to date. 29 31 CERESTAT: Stroke In 1994, the American Heart Association estimated that there are approximately 500,000 incidents of stroke in the United States each year and that approximately 350,000 people survive the event. Currently, there are approximately three million disabled stroke survivors in the United States, and the annual economic cost of stroke to the United States has been estimated at $30.0 billion. In July 1996, the FDA approved the use of tissue plasminogen activator ("tPA") for the treatment of patients who had suffered a stroke within the preceding three hours and for whom a CT scan showed no evidence of hemorrhage. This action was based on a study published in the New England Journal of Medicine in 1995, in which the percent of patients deemed eligible to participate was less than 4% of all patients screened. Intravenous tPA acts by dissolving blood clots that might have led to a stroke. To date, there are no FDA-approved treatments for stroke that act by any mechanism other than dissolving blood clots which limit or reduce the brain damage associated with the cerebral ischemia. A Phase III clinical trial of CERESTAT in stroke patients was initiated in July 1996. The intent is to enroll 900 patients at approximately 110 centers in the United States, Canada, Australia, South Africa and the United Kingdom. Patients enrolled in the trial are randomized for intravenous treatment with either placebo or one of two dosing regimens of CERESTAT. The primary outcome measure has been defined as the modified Rankin Scale (a measure of disability) three months after the stroke. An interim analysis is planned to be performed on the seven day post-stroke NIH Stroke Scale data of the first 300 patients. The main purpose of the interim analysis is administrative, and the trial would be halted only if continuation were futile. To date, over 150 patients have been enrolled in this trial. This trial is being monitored by an independent safety committee. In stroke patients, the central nervous system side effects of CERESTAT include sedation, paresthesias (numbness) and occasional episodes of altered sensorium, including hallucinations. The Company believes that these side effects are transitory and manageable. Increases in blood pressure have also been observed and have been controlled, when necessary. CNS 5161: Post-Surgical Neuropathic Pain and Neurological Deficits From Cardiac Surgery. The potential market for prophylaxis against neuropathic pain has been identified based on approximately 650,000 procedures performed annually in the United States. Glutamate (particularly NMDA) receptors have been implicated in the induction and maintenance of such pain in animal models and NMDA antagonists have been shown to be effective in animal models of persistent pain. It has been estimated that there were over 600,000 open heart surgery procedures in the United States in 1993. Neuropsychological deficits are observed within an eight-day period in up to 70% of patients undergoing such procedures and in up to 30% of patients one year after the surgery. The Company believes that these deficits are related to the transient cerebral ischemia that occurs in some patients undergoing open-heart surgery. The Company believes that an NMDA ion-channel blocker given prophylactically could attenuate these undesirable consequences of the surgery. CNS 5161 is a blocker of the NMDA ion channel that was synthesized by the Company's chemists to be chemically distinct from CERESTAT. Based on its method of action and its pharmacokinetic profile in animals, CNS 5161 is being advanced toward clinical evaluation for the prevention of post-surgical neuropathic pain and of neuropsychological deficits that result from transient cerebral ischemia during major cardiac surgeries, such as coronary artery bypass graft (CABG) surgery. Studies in animals have shown that CNS 5161 can limit the extent of brain damage following periods of cerebral ischemia. Other animal studies have shown that this compound can also prevent the development of a delayed pain response, which is thought to be related to the development of chronic neuropathic pain in humans following certain surgeries or trauma. The Company intends to initiate clinical trials of CNS 5161 in human volunteers by mid-1997. BI has the right to negotiate a development and marketing agreement for CNS 5161 for the treatment of brain or spinal cord ischemia. See "-- Strategic Alliances." 30 32 Ion-Channel Blockers for Ophthalmic Disorders Ion-channel blockers may have utility in certain diseases outside the central nervous system, such as glaucoma and other ophthalmic indications. To this end, in November 1996, the Company entered into a collaboration with Allergan, a pharmaceutical company specializing in ophthalmology. In this collaboration, the Company's molecules which block NMDA ion channels, sodium ion channels or both will be evaluated for their ability to prevent vision loss in animal models of the degeneration of the retina and optic nerve which occurs in glaucoma. See "--Strategic Alliances." Other Ion-Channel Blockers for Nervous System Disorders The Company believes that molecules which block the ion channels of nerve cells have potential as treatments for a number of nervous system disorders. Accordingly, the Company continues to synthesize and evaluate molecules for their ability to block ion channels of therapeutic importance. To discover new treatments for preventing disorders of the central nervous system which arise from cerebral or spinal cord ischemia, the Company has synthesized ion-channel blockers with enhanced potency in the environment of ischemic tissues relative to their potency in the environment of normal tissues. The Company believes that such targeted ion-channel blockers could achieve efficacy with fewer unwanted side effects. In addition to molecules which block NMDA ion channels, the Company has created a library of small organic molecules which block the sodium ion channels of nerve cells. In vitro and in vivo studies have demonstrated that sodium ion-channel blockers can protect nerve cells from ischemic damage and can exert other beneficial effects, such as preventing seizure activity, reducing responses to painful stimuli, limiting the consequences of traumatic damage to nerve fiber bundles and arresting migraine attacks. The Company believes that molecules which block neuronal sodium ion channels have potential as treatments for various forms of acute and chronic disorders of the nervous system, including stroke, epilepsy, pain and migraine. The Company has recently been working with the Epilepsy Branch at the National Institutes of Health to explore the potential of its sodium ion-channel blockers as treatments for epilepsy. As an extension of its work in NMDA and sodium ion-channel blockers, the Company has synthesized molecules which have the capacity to block both NMDA ion channels and sodium ion channels. The Company is currently conducting in vitro and in vivo studies to test the hypothesis that such combination compounds have enhanced efficacy in treating neurological disorders when compared to the efficacy of compounds which block only one of these classes of ion channels. PROTEIN GROWTH FACTORS rhGGF2: Multiple Sclerosis The Company is developing the protein growth factor rhGGF2 for the treatment of multiple sclerosis. MS is a disease of the central nervous system that is characterized by chronic inflammation and demyelination at multiple sites in the brain and spinal cord. Approximately 350,000 people in the United States suffer from MS. The Company is aware of three therapeutics currently being marketed to treat MS, which are Betaseron[R] (Chiron Corporation/Schering AG), Avonex[R] (Biogen, Inc.) and Copaxone[R] (Teva Pharmaceutical Industries Ltd./Hoechst Marion Roussel Ltd.) and are all based on an immunosuppression approach to the disease, rather than the growth factor approach being pursued by the Company. Cambridge NeuroScience is investigating rhGGF2 in preclinical studies as a therapeutic intervention in the pathological processes involved in MS. rhGGF2 is a trophic factor for the glial cells that form and maintain the myelin sheath insulating nerve axons in the central nervous system. These cells are primary targets involved early in the pathogenesis of MS. The Company has produced purified rhGGF2 and is currently examining its efficacy in animal models of MS, including experimental autoimmune encephalomyelitis ("EAE"). In the acute phase of this model, rhGGF2 significantly reduced and delayed the clinical symptoms. In the chronic, relapsing-remitting phase of EAE, rhGGF2 significantly reduced the 31 33 clinical effects of the disease as well as the number of observed relapses. The Company has initiated the process leading to the production of GMP quantities of rhGGF2 for use in clinical trials. rhGGF2: Peripheral Neuropathies The Company believes that rhGGF2 may also be a potential treatment for peripheral neuropathies as a result of its activity on peripheral glial cells. Peripheral neuropathies comprise a collection of disorders that are characterized by the degeneration of sensory and/or motor nerves. This degeneration may be caused by injury, chemotherapy, diabetes, inherited disorders and other factors. It was estimated in 1991 that in excess of one million individuals in the United States suffered from some form of peripheral neuropathy. The largest segments of this population are those with chemotherapy-induced neuropathies and those with diabetic neuropathies. There are, at present, no FDA-approved therapeutic agents for the prevention, reduction or reversal of the degeneration and atrophy caused by these disorders and injuries. The Company is currently testing rhGGF2 in animal models of peripheral neuropathies, such as cancer-chemotherapy-induced neuropathy. In two different experimental paradigms (cisplatin-induced and vincristine-induced neuropathies), rhGGF2 administration protected peripheral nerves from the effects of these chemotherapies. The Company also believes that rhGGF2 may be a potential treatment of other degenerative diseases of the peripheral nerves. rhGGF2: Other Indications Cambridge NeuroScience continues to explore the therapeutic potential of rhGGF2 in applications beyond the central nervous system. For example, rhGGF2 has been shown to have survival actions on retinal nerve cells and inner ear cells. Company scientists continue to monitor these findings and are currently investigating the therapeutic potential of rhGGF2 in an animal model of hearing loss. Small Molecule Discovery Program Related to GGF2 Based on its experience with rhGGF2 and other members of this protein family, referred to as neuregulins, the Company entered into a collaboration with ProsCure, Inc. ("ProsCure") in 1995 to identify small molecule compounds for cancer treatments. As a result of this collaboration, it was discovered that certain compounds can antagonize the activity of neuregulins. The Company believes that compounds with such activity may be useful in the treatment of breast, ovarian, brain and other cancers. Other Protein Growth Factors The Company is also conducting research into other growth factors that may have utility in the treatment of other disorders of the nervous system. GDF-1 is a member of the TGF-SS superfamily, and is broadly and exclusively expressed in the nervous system. The Company believes that GDF-1 is likely to play a role in responses to injury, ischemia and demyelination. Human recombinant GDF-1 is currently being produced at Cambridge NeuroScience and will be evaluated as a potential therapeutic for nerve injury or neurological disease. Several members of the TGF-SS gene family have biological activities that potentially can be employed for therapeutic effects in the nervous system, including: the promotion of dopaminergic neuron survival, which may be applicable as a treatment for Parkinson's disease, the promotion of motor neuron survival, which may be applicable as a treatment for amyotrophic lateral sclerosis, and immunosuppression, which may be applicable as a treatment for MS. F-Spondin is a protein made by an important region of the developing spinal cord, the floorplate. Since it is related to a protein known to be active in the sciatic nerve injury model, recombinant F-Spondin will be tested for peripheral nerve regeneration. The Company believes that F-Spondin is an attractive candidate molecule for therapeutic situations involving repair of the spinal cord or peripheral nervous system. 32 34 STRATEGIC ALLIANCES The Company's strategy includes forming collaborations with pharmaceutical companies to assist in the development of its potential products, provide capital for such development and share development risk. Boehringer Ingelheim International GmbH In March 1995, Cambridge NeuroScience and BI entered into an agreement to collaborate on the worldwide development and commercialization of CERESTAT. Under the terms of the agreement, BI is obligated to fund 75% of the development costs for CERESTAT in the United States and Europe and all of the development costs in Japan. Under the agreement, product development is managed by a Joint Development Team, with equal representation from both companies. This team is supervised by a Joint Steering Committee, with two members from each company. Upon signing the agreement, the Company received $15.0 million, consisting of $5.0 million for expense reimbursement and $10.0 million for 1,250,000 shares of Common Stock. In September 1996, and in connection with the commencement of the pivotal stroke trial by BI, the Company received a milestone payment of $10.0 million for 1,237,624 shares of Common Stock. The Company may receive up to an additional $18.0 million in cash without the issuance of additional equity after achieving certain other milestones and will receive royalties on product sales. Cambridge NeuroScience has an option to co-promote CERESTAT in the United States with BI and the Company has notified BI of its intent to exercise this option upon completion of a separate agreement. BI will market the product in Europe and other geographic regions exclusively and will pay the Company royalties on sales. Cambridge NeuroScience has retained worldwide manufacturing rights. BI has an option to acquire the worldwide manufacturing rights in exchange for increased royalty payments. Under the terms of the agreement, BI has certain termination rights, including the right to terminate the agreement upon 90 days written notice to the Company. See "-- Marketing and Sales" and "-- Manufacturing." Allergan In November 1996, the Company entered into a collaboration with Allergan to jointly develop NMDA ion-channel blockers, sodium ion-channel blockers and combination ion-channel blockers, initially for the treatment of ophthalmic indications, including glaucoma. Glaucoma is the second leading cause of preventable blindness in the world, with almost three million patients in the United States alone. The disease is usually associated with increased pressure within the eye, which can damage the retina and the optic nerve and eventually lead to blindness. The Company and Allergan believe that it may be possible to treat glaucoma by blocking ion channels and thereby protecting the retina and the optic nerve from damage. This collaboration combines the Company's proprietary technology in the area of ion-channel blockers and Allergan's expertise in the global marketing of treatments for eye disease and allows Cambridge NeuroScience to explore additional areas of clinical need. Upon signing the agreement, Allergan purchased 175,103 shares of Common Stock from the Company for $3.0 million. Allergan will provide an additional $3.0 million in research funding over the next three years, subject to certain provisions, and has established a $2.0 million line of credit for the Company. The collaboration is supervised by a Research Management Committee, with equal representation from both parties. Allergan will be responsible for the development of potential products and will bear all of the development costs. Cambridge NeuroScience may receive up to an additional $18.5 million in cash upon the achievement of certain milestones and will receive a royalty on any product sales. Allergan will manufacture and market products developed under the collaboration worldwide. Allergan has certain termination rights under the terms of the agreement. Allergan may terminate the research phase of the collaboration if the Research Management Committee determines that there is no reasonable scientific 33 35 basis for the commercialization of products covered by the collaboration. Allergan may terminate the agreement at any time after May 1998 upon six months prior written notice. Either party may, in its sole discretion, terminate the agreement upon 90 days prior written notice upon a material breach by the other party. ProsCure, Inc. GOVERNMENT REGULATION The manufacture and marketing of pharmaceutical products in the United States require the approval of the FDA under the Federal Food, Drug and Cosmetic Act. Similar approvals by comparable agencies are required in most foreign countries. The FDA has established mandatory procedures and safety standards which apply to the preclinical testing and clinical trials, as well as to the manufacture and marketing of pharmaceutical products. Pharmaceutical manufacturing facilities are also regulated by state, local and other authorities. As an initial step in the FDA regulatory approval process, preclinical studies are typically conducted in animal models to assess a drug's efficacy and to identify potential safety problems. The results of these studies must be submitted to the FDA as part of an IND application, which must be reviewed by the FDA before proposed clinical testing can begin. Typically, clinical testing involves a three-phase process. Phase I clinical trials are conducted with a small number of subjects and are designed to provide information about both product safety and the expected dose of the drug. Phase II clinical trials are designed to provide additional information on dosing and safety in a limited patient population; on occasion, they may provide evidence of product efficacy. Phase III clinical trials are large-scale studies designed to provide statistically valid proof of efficacy as well as safety in the target patient population. The results of the preclinical testing and clinical trials of a pharmaceutical product are then submitted to the FDA in the form of an NDA, or for a biological product in the form of a Product License Application ("PLA"), for approval to commence commercial sales. Preparing such applications involves considerable data collection, verification, analysis, and expense. In responding to an NDA or a PLA, the FDA may grant marketing approval, request additional information, or deny the application if it determines that the application does not satisfy its regulatory approval criteria. Certain other conditions and restrictions apply to such registrations. 44 46 DELAWARE TAKEOVER STATUTE In February 1988, a law regulating corporate takeovers (the "Takeover Law") took effect in Delaware. In certain circumstances, the Takeover Law prevents certain Delaware corporations, including those whose securities are listed on the Nasdaq National Market, from engaging in a "business combination" (which includes a merger or sale of more than 10% of the corporation's assets) with any "interested stockholder" (a stockholder who owns 15% or more of the corporation's outstanding voting stock) for three (3) years following the date on which such stockholder became an "interested stockholder." A Delaware corporation may "opt out" of the Takeover Law with an express provision either in its original Certificate of Incorporation or in its Certificate of Incorporation or By-laws resulting from an amendment approved by at least a majority of the outstanding voting shares. The Company is a Delaware corporation that is subject to the Takeover Law and has not "opted out" of its provisions. The foregoing provisions of Delaware law could have the effect of discouraging others from attempting hostile takeovers of the Company and, as a consequence, they may also inhibit temporary fluctuations in the market price of the Common Stock that often result from actual or rumored hostile takeover attempts. Such provisions may also have the effect of preventing changes in the management of the Company. It is possible that such provisions could make it more difficult to accomplish transactions which stockholders may otherwise deem to be in their best interests.
